In Art, it’s personal. As part of the A-level Art, Photography or Textiles courses available at Fyling Hall School each student is expected to complete a Personal Study project and essay for their coursework. Our Year 13 students are well and truly into their project and are facing their crucial essay writing during our online lessons. The Year 12 students have chosen their project topics and are getting to grips with what this means to them, again, during tough times and online learning.

“We have every faith in our students. They are hardworking, conscientious and talented. That said, we are very aware of the challenges ahead for our students and want to give them as much guidance as possible during these testing times for us all,” commented Miss Mansfield, Head of Art. 

The Art Department have provided a clear and cohesive outline to give the best guide to their students. This guide gives a detailed breakdown of a writing framework which students of all abilities can access. This alongside one-to-one online meetings with each student as well as group sessions will give our students the best opportunity during these trying times. In Art, it really is personal.
